About the Role:
We’re looking for a creative and passionate UI/UX designer to collaborate on an exciting mobile game being developed in Unity. Whether you're just starting out or have years of experience, we encourage you to apply. The game is a social simulation, inspired by titles like Animal Crossing, and you'll be working on key systems such as inventory management, settings, and general user interactions.
What We're Looking For:
We need a designer who not only loves games but also deeply understands the importance of intuitive and artfully crafted UI. We're searching for someone who thinks about UI/UX beyond just functionality, and who is passionate about graphic design and art direction—key elements in creating a compelling game experience.
Key Responsibilities:
- Design and deliver high-quality UI elements (wireframes, assets, specs, and prototypes) that communicate gameplay effectively.
- Create clean, efficient, playful, and intuitive interfaces that enhance user experience across various game systems.
- Collaborate closely with Unity developers to ensure smooth implementation of final UI designs.
Qualifications:
- Must have a strong interest in gaming and a passion for designing game UI/UX.
- Must have a portfolio that includes sample UI mockups (either implemented or conceptual).
- Must have a solid background in graphic design.
- Experience with Unity UI Toolkit is a plus.
